Just after completing the fourth season of Petticoat Junction, Burnette became ill. [1] On February 16, 1967, a month prior to his 56th birthday, he died in Encino, California, from leukemia and was interred in Forest Lawn Memorial Park in Hollywood Hills, California. Mascot was soon absorbed by Republic Pictures Corp., and Burnette teamed up with Autry for the studio as his lovable comedic sidekick, Frog Millhouse, with his trademark floppy black hat. He spent time in Springfield, Missouri, from the late 1940s into the 1950s producing a nationally syndicated 15-minute radio program, The Smiley Burnette Show, through RadiOzark Enterprises. When the cowboy movie genre waned, Burnette retired but made guest appearances on many country music radio and TV shows, including Louisiana Hayride, the Grand Ole Opry, and Ranch Party.

Lester Alvin Burnett (March 18, 1911 – February 16, 1967), better known as Smiley Burnette, was a popular American country music performer and a comedic actor in Western films and on radio and TV, playing sidekick to Gene Autry and other B-movie cowboys.
